A leading hospitality brand is looking for a passionate Restaurant Supervisor at their St Ives location. This role involves supporting the restaurant's daily operations and ensuring a high standard of service.
Applicants should have at least one year of experience in a restaurant, ideally with supervisory experience, and possess excellent communication skills.
The company provides competitive salary packages, career progression, and employee benefits, fostering a supportive workplace environment.

How to prepare for a job interview at Harbour Hotel St Ives
✨Know the Brand Inside Out
Before your interview, do some homework on the hospitality brand. Understand their values, mission, and what sets them apart in the industry. This will not only impress your interviewers but also help you tailor your answers to align with their expectations.
✨Showcase Your Supervisory Skills
Since the role requires supervisory experience, be ready to discuss specific examples from your past roles. Highlight situations where you led a team, resolved conflicts, or improved service standards.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your responses.
✨Demonstrate Excellent Communication
As a Restaurant Supervisor, communication is key. During the interview, practice clear and confident communication. Listen carefully to questions and respond thoughtfully. You might even want to ask insightful questions about the team dynamics or customer service strategies to show your engagement.
✨Emphasise Your Passion for Hospitality
Let your enthusiasm for the hospitality industry shine through. Share why you love working in restaurants and how you strive to create memorable experiences for guests. This passion can set you apart from other candidates and resonate well with the interviewers.
